For the past two years, Pedigree has teamed up with bloggers across the country through the "Write a Post, Help a Dog" initiative.  The program has generated nearly 650 blog posts to both create and raise awareness to support the importance of adoption and the need to feed sheltered pooches.  Last year alone, the blog entries resulted in a donation of 2,980 pounds of Pedigree's then-new dry dog food to shelters that had been hit by Hurricane Irene.

This year, a team of bloggers who are sponsored by Pedigree (like this one) are teaming up once again at the BlogPaws Pet Blogging Conference in Salt Lake City, Utah to continue the success.  Effective immediately and active until midnight on June 30th, for every blog post written with reference to the "Write a Post, Help a Dog" project as well as Pedigree's commitment to the adoption of and placement into loving homes for shelter dogs, Pedigree will donate 1 x 17 pound bag of their dry dog food to shelters in need - up to 450 bags!

So that is the goal for 2012 - let's help them generate 450 blog posts to ensure Pedigree can donate the grand total of 7,650 pounds of food to shelters in need across the country!
